The Equipment Youll Require

Smoking Steaks On Masterbuilt Electric Smoker | BUMMERS BAR-B-Q

Were sure youre wondering if the products you need are hard to come by, but guess what? They arent. The majority of the items are standard. In addition, not everything will be used to clean all of the smokers components, as some are easier to clean than others.

Youll need a metal container, a soft brush, a cleaning cloth, a spray bottle, and sponges for the most part. To avoid scratching your smoke, we recommend using a soft bristle brush rather than a metal brush.

Additionally, we recommend using diluted apple cider vinegar in a spray bottle if possible to clean your smoker. Use half and half water and apple cider vinegar to make the perfect acidic natural cleaning solution. Apple cider vinegar eliminates bacteria, but to get rid of the vinegar odor, youll need to re-season your smoker after cleaning.

What Is Reverse Sear Cooking

Let me explain. When you google perfectly cooked steak, what you will typically see is the more traditional restaurant method, which is where the meat is seared hot and then finished in the oven to finish cooking. But what I want to share is something that adds incredible flavor and allows you to finish with that beautiful crusted texture. The reverse sear. And better yet, the SMOKED reverse sear.

And here you thought you couldnt achieve a perfectly cooked steak on a smoker?!

The idea is, instead of sear first then finish in the oven, you smoke it first at a low temperature to get the smoky flavor, and then finish it by searing for the beautiful and flavorful crust. But first, lets talk about

How To Season A Steak

Season simply with salt and pepper. Thats it. Nothing more is needed for a good cut of beef . And if youre going to invest your money in a quality cut of meat , why drown out those natural flavors with noise . Good meat doesnt need it. S& P is all you need.

You can use prime, wagyu, or something local. The key is to look for good marbling. We salted this cut on both sides lightly and then left in fridge for a quick dry brine over a couple of hours. The salt disappears as it is absorbed into the meat.

My Masterbuilt Electric Smoker Is Not Smoking

The Masterbuilt electric smoker is not a high smoke unit. Electric smokers main appeal is their ease of operation over charcoal or propane smokers. We can do a few things to help. There are even ways to improvise that will improve your smokers output.

First, before we modify anything always double-check that the wood chip tray is clean each time you use your smoker. Fill the wood chip tray halfway with chips and wait for it to start smoking prior to beginning the normal chip loading process.

Crush a few pieces of charcoal into four chunks, and put a few chunks into the tray before you start. Then add one chunk of charcoal each time you load chips into your smoker. By adding charcoal, the burning temperature will increase and add a nice charcoal flavor.

Run your smoker above 200 degrees, because the thermostat will turn the heating element off when it reaches the temperature setting. At this point, your chips will stop burning. Due to how the thermostat works this smoker would be a very poor choice for cold smoking, but we can fix that.

There are many ways to add smoke to your unit. A factory smoke generator, an Amazin smoke tray, or even an external burner tray modification. The Masterbuilt smoke generator is by far the easiest way to go and will provide the best experience.

My favorite device for all-around ease of use is tray Amazinsmoke tray. You load the tray with pellets of your choice, light the cornerwith a torch, and put it on the bottom tray of your smoker.

Why Wont My Wood Chips Smoke

It is not uncommon to think that your wood chips are not creating enough smoke.

The most common reason for wood chips not to smoke is the wood is too dry, which can happen as a result of over-seasoning. The second reason is that the wood chips are not at their ideal smoking temperature. If they are below 570 degrees F, then they will not begin to smoke at all.

Having a temperature too high can also cause the wood chips to burn too quickly, so there is a lack of smoke and flavor.

Best Smoking Wood Choices For Ribeye Steaks

Like weve done previously with smoked lamb chops, since you are only smoking these ribeye steaks for a shorter period of time relative to something like a ham or leg of lamb, you can get away with using some stronger flavored smoking woods.

We prefer the mid range smokey flavor of hickory wood on our smoked ribeyes, but if you want an even bolder flavor you can try using mesquite.

If you DO want to try mesquite, we would only recommend applying smoke for the first 30 minutes and no longer.

Otherwise, your ribeyes can get TOO smokey and the mesquite will overpwer them.

If you are looking for a milder wood to smoke them with, you can try oak, apple, or cherry instead.

Vacuum Seal For 2 Weeks Before Serving

Next comes the hardest part about smoking cheesethe waiting.

After you have let your cheese breathe for 24-48 hours in the refrigerator you need to let it mellow.

You will need to place it in an airtight container such as a zip lock bag, or better yet, a vacuum sealed bag and put it back in the refrigerator for at least2 WEEKS.

We know, its hard to wait and you want to try it now, but trust us, it will be sooooo much better in a couple weeks.

This will give the smoke flavors that accumulated on the outside of the cheese time to permeate into the rest of the cheese and also mellow out in flavor.

How To Choose The Right Cheese For Cold Smoking

Smoked in a Masterbuilt

Even though youll be using a cold smoker, you still need to choose a cheese that has a higher melting point than the rest.

Solid milk fat in cheese traditionally begins to melt at 90 degrees Fahrenheit, so choosing a cheese that has a melting point lower than this will make the task even harder.

Cheddar, halloumi, gouda, and mozzarella are all great cheeses to choose from due to their higher melting points.

Additionally, dont feel as though you need to buy premium cheese for smoking. Even inexpensive supermarket cheese will work fine and becomes delicious after being smoked.

Vertical Or Offset Charcoal Smoker

The entry level Char-Broil Offset Barrel Smoker.

Fill your firebox or lower charcoal basin with a few handfuls of unlit charcoal and create a small hollowed out depression in the center where you can add your lit briquets.

If your smoker comes with a water pan, like the Weber Smokey Mountain, fill the water pan as well to help stabilize the temperature and add moisture to the cooking chamber.

Light a charcoal chimney about 1/4 way with charcoal and wait about 15 minutes for it to fully ignite.

Fill your water pan first, then add the lit briquets to the center depression you created.

Keep the dampers about 1/2 way to 3/4 open until the temperature is to about 180 deg F. Then slowly close them down until they are just barely open and you are maintaining a temperature of 225 deg F.

Place 1 chunk of smoking wood on top of your lit charcoal once the smoker is up to temperature and put your ribeye steaks on.

Meanwhile prepare a skillet or separate grill to reverse sear the steaks when they are ready to be taken off.

What Should The Internal Temperature Of Steak Be

The best way to check when the kabobs are done is to check the internal temperature of the steak with an Instant Read Meat Thermometer.

Each person will have a different preference on what the internal temperature should be, but listed below is a guide.

We prefer ours in the 120-140 degree F range.

  • Rare: 120 degrees F
  • Medium Rare: 130 degrees F
  • Medium: 145 degrees F

At What Temperature Do Wood Chips Smoke

It takes around 20 minutes for the wood chips to start smoking. Wood chips will begin to smoke at a temperature between 570 and 750 degrees Fahrenheit .

All smoke chips will start smoking at these temperatures, but the rate of smoldering will vary. Fruity wood chips such as apple and peach, will burn much faster than nut wood chips like pecan or hardwoods like hickory.

If the wood chips you use have a lower temperature than 570 degrees F, then they will not smolder properly, and your food will not be infused with a smoky flavor.

Clean The Individual Parts

Smoked Steaks (NY Strip) On The Masterbuilt Electric Smoker | BUMMERS BAR-B-Q & SOUTHERN COOKING

The portions listed below are some of the most critical parts of most Masterbuilt models that must be cleaned after use.

  • The Racks

During the seasoning process of a smoker, such as the Masterbuilt MES 140s Digital Electric Smoker, it is necessary to oil the racks. It prevents food from adhering to the racks and rusting them. However, leftovers of cooking liquid can build during basting, prompting cleanup.

The first step is to remove any leftovers with a brush and a cleaning cloth. Scrub it with apple cider vinegar after that, but soapy water will suffice.

This helps to get rid of all the grease on the racks. Scrubbing them with hot water is recommended since it is more effective at eliminating grease.

After a pre-clean, many people will throw food racks and drip trays in the dishwasher. For best results, use a high heat setting and a minimal amount of dishwasher soap.

  • The Ashtray

When wood chips are used, ashes collect in the ashtray. You should wipe the ashtray before using it again to avoid it being overcrowded. Youll need a metal container, apple cider vinegar, and hot water to clean it.

Begin by collecting all of the ashes in a metal can and cleaning the tray with a water-apple cider vinegar combination. After youve sprayed the liquid on the tray and let it dry, finish it up with a brush or cleaning cloth. Always remember to clean the ashtray since if it is left out for too long, the soot will blacken it.

Add More Wood Chips And Refill The Smokers Water Pan:

When the first batch of wood chips has stopped making smoke, add more to the tray. Make sure you add just half a cup at a time. Using too many wood chips can alter the flavor of the food giving it an overwhelming smoky taste.

Based on the instruction manual, follow the steps, and refill the water pan whenever it empties. The water in the pan turns to steam and this keeps the meat tender and juicy as it gets smoked.

Can You Smoke A Steak

Of course you can! In fact, I think youll find that smoking a steak gives it a unique, delicious flavor that you cant get by cooking it on the grill. Plus, depending on the flavor of pellets you use, you can infuse it will all sorts of tasty flavor.

And did you know smoking a steak is easy peasy? Thats right. Its one of the most basic ways to prepare a steak. Simply season with salt and pepper and smoke for ALL the flavor that your steak will need. You dont need any fancy rubs or sauces the smoked steak will taste incredible without any frills.

Heres How To Smoke A Steak With This Simple Rub:

masterbuilt smoker pork steaks

First add wood chips or pellets into your smoker. We used mesquite, it creates delicious flavors.

Now, preheat your smoker to 250 and rub seasonings on your steaks on both sides.

Then, place them inside and let them soak up the smoky flavor.

But stay close! It wont take an hour of smoking unless your cuts are REALLY thick. Typically 45 minutes is plenty of time.
